The paper will unfold Bill Clinton profile from his unseas integrityd ages up to his highest leadership position in his life history Bill Clinton was born as William Jefferson Blythe on 19th august 1946 in Hope, Arkansas. His father died when he was at the age of three years in a severe road accident. At the age of four years, his mother married a second hand car dealer. At this early stage, Clinton portrayed his concern over faith and racial prejudice in United States of America. Young Bill Clinton spent approximately of his times with his grandfather who taught him on the take in for equality between the whites and blacks in USA. At his tender age, Bill Clinton also expressed extraordinary intemperate attitudes towards religion. In his homestead, Bill Clinton was the only person who was attending church services. His concern over racis m and religion during his early ages represented Bill Clinton as a gifted person in the society. At his teenaged age, Bill Clinton assumed the head of the family role. Bills step father was an alcoholic and in most cases he turned violent to his mother. Bill was furious of his fathers acts and in one position he warned him against battering his mother. Clinton even went further in assisting his mother to divorce through requesting his mothers attorney to report the abuse of his stepfather. In his high school education, Bill Clinton excelled as a saxophone player and as a student. At this time, he also considered to train as a pro musician. It is during his high school age that Bill Clinton met President John Kennedy in white house in 1960s. This encounter enabled Bill Clinton to enter into public service life. As a scholar, Bill portrayed astound performance in the course of his scholarly career. He attended Georgetown University and graduated in 1968. In his university life, Cli nton accomplish the position as an assistant to Senator Fulbright William. Bill used this position to earn political experience from one of the most respected and senior politician in United States of America. Fulbright also encouraged Bill to bear for Rhodes scholarship. Bill complied with Fulbright advice and applied for the scholarship. As a result of his application, Clinton was elected as the 63 Rhodes scholars in the wide-cut country.
